A Deeper Look at Chinese Food Styles

The world of Chinese cuisine is vast and varied, with each region boasting its unique flavors and cooking techniques. Cantonese cuisine, originating from Guangdong province in southern China, is known for its delicate flavors and emphasis on fresh ingredients. Dishes are often stir-fried or steamed, highlighting the natural flavors of the vegetables, seafood, and meats. Szechuan cuisine, on the other hand, is characterized by its bold and spicy flavors. The use of Szechuan peppercorns creates a unique numbing sensation, while chili peppers add heat and complexity. Dishes are often stir-fried or braised, with a focus on creating a balance of flavors. While it might be challenging to find true regional authenticity in a smaller town like Thomaston, understanding these differences can help you appreciate the nuances of each dish.

It’s also worth noting the prevalence of Americanized Chinese food. Dishes like General Tso’s Chicken and Crab Rangoon, while delicious in their own right, are creations that cater to the American palate. They often feature sweeter sauces, deep-fried preparations, and a focus on convenience.

Ordering Tips and Considerations

Navigating a Chinese menu can be overwhelming, especially if you have dietary restrictions or preferences. Here are some tips to help you order with confidence:

Dietary Restrictions

If you’re vegetarian or vegan, be sure to ask about ingredients like oyster sauce, fish sauce, and chicken broth, which are commonly used in many dishes. Tofu is often a good substitute for meat, but be sure to confirm that it’s prepared without animal products. For those with gluten sensitivities, look for dishes that are naturally gluten-free, such as stir-fries with rice noodles or steamed vegetables.

Spice Levels

Don’t be afraid to ask your server about the spice level of a dish. Many restaurants are willing to adjust the amount of chili peppers or Szechuan peppercorns to your liking. If you’re unsure, start with a milder option and add chili oil or chili flakes to taste.

Ordering for a Group

Chinese food is often served family-style, with dishes shared among the table. This is a great way to try a variety of flavors and textures. When ordering for a group, choose a mix of dishes with different proteins, vegetables, and sauces to ensure everyone has something to enjoy.
